Greg - I'll probably provide information of which you may be aware. Again -
DEP is provided via hardware - AMD processors with NX feature and Intel
processors with the XD (Execute disable feature).
If hardware DEP is not avaiable, Vista and XP SVC PK2 utilize software
DEP -applications must be written to utilize DEP. Not all platforms
(computers) support DEP.

Although "NX" is a specific feature of select AMD processors, Intel
processor equipped computers will
acknowledge BCDedit.exe commands involving NX as completed successfully (Bug
?).

Also "Physical Address Extension" (PAE) mode must be enabled for DEP to be
active. To the best of my knowledge, functioning software DEP cannot be
completely "turned off" (Registry hack?).
Unavailable options (Greyed out) via Control Panel indicate DEP is not
functional on that computer(?).

>> Data Execution Prevention (DEP), UAC and ReadyBoost are generally not
>> understood well.
>>
>> Major techniques in exploiting Windows are via buffer overflow (CodeRed
>> Worm). DEP reduces risk of buffer overflow attacks by designating
>> sections
>> of memory for data or code only.
>>
>> The OS will not run code in memory designated for data - DEP (hardware
>> based) with Kernel Patch Protection is a major security provider in 64
>> bit
>> OS.
>>
>> In 32 bit versions DEP is software based and availability depends upon
>> the
>> processor. It is enabled by default and, by default, protects only
>> essential Windows programs and services - you can protect other programs
>> and
>> services
